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Patients diagnosed with ACLF as per APASL criteria with AARC score of ≥8

Exclusion

  • Uncontrolled sepsis
  • Septic shock requiring inotropes despite fluid resuscitation
  • Active or recent bleeding (unless controlled for \>48 hours).
  • Severe thrombocytopenia (≤20×10\^9/L)
  • Acute kidney injury with Creatinine \> 2 or the need of RRT
  • Respiratory failure (Severe ARDS)
  • Chronic kidney disease
  • Hepatocellular carcinoma outside Milan criteria (1 nodule ≤5 cm or 3 nodules ≤3 cm)
  • HIV infection
  • Pregnancy
